Equation 1)  2x - 2y = 10
Equation 2)  4x - 5y = 17

Multiply ALL of equation 1 by 2.

1)  2(2x - 2y = 10)

Simplify.

1)  4x - 4y = 20
2)  4x - 5y = 17

Subtract equations from one another.

y = 3

Plug in 3 for y in the first equation.

1)  2x - 2y = 10

2x - 2(3) = 10

Simplify.

2x - 6 = 10

Add 6 to both side.s

2x = 16

Divide both sides by 2.

x = 8

------------------------------------
Check your work by plugging in 8 for x, and 3 for y into the original equations.

2x - 2y = 10 & 4x - 5y = 17

1)  2x - 2y = 10

2(8) - 2(3) = 10

Simplify.

16 - 6 = 10

10 = 10 

2)  4x - 5y = 17

4(8) - 5(3) = 17

Simplify.

32 - 15 = 17

17 = 17

Therefore, x = 8, y = 3
